If you haven’t tried gozleme before then you’re in for a treat. It is a classic Turkish creation that wraps a flatbread around all sorts of tasty savoury fillings. The bread can be leavened or unleavened and is usually a combination of flour, water, and olive oil or Greek yoghurt.

Treat the pastry with care
Gluten free flour doesn’t deal well with being overworked. Instead, gently knead until it forms a smooth dough, and then stop.
Transfer with the right utensil
Low carb flour doesn’t have the same elasticity as wheat flour, so use a fish slice or pizza paddle to transfer the gozlemes in one piece.
Keep them small
The smaller they are, the easier the gozlemes are to flip and transfer.
Use plenty of oil
To get a crispier pastry coating, use a liberal splash of oil.
Use baking paper to roll
We find the best way to roll out the pastry is by placing it between two sheets of baking paper. This stops it from sticking and breaking up.
